#932d95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#932d95 is composed of 57.6% red, 17.6%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 69.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 298.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.6% and a lightness of 38%. #932d95 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#27002b.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

● #932d95 color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#932d95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#932d95 has RGB values of R:147, G:45,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9645461.

Shades and Tints of #932d95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d040d is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#932d95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#685a68 is the less saturated color, while #be00c2 is the most saturated one.
